The SEM Committee is organising a workshop on the FASS Market Power and Mandatory Participation Consultation published on 31 July 2026.
The consultation sets out the SEM Committee’s considerations in terms of options to address potential market power abuses in System Services Markets as part of the Future Arrangements for System Services (FASS) project.
The paper considers targeted interventions to mitigate the risk of abuse of market power; These include market design changes, unit-specific controls, financial interventions, and a System Services Bidding Code of Practice (SS BCoP). The paper also seeks to address concerns around market participation requirements. It sets out a range of options for accession to the System Services Code, participation in the Day-Ahead System Services Auction (DASSA) and participation in the Residual Availability Determination (RAD).
